Functional description
For additional information, see the USB 2.0 specification.
Host
Software
Figure 33-5. Example USB 2.0 system configuration
33.2.3 USBFS Features
• USB 1.1 and 2.0 compatible FS device controller
• 16 bidirectional endpoints
• DMA or FIFO data stream interfaces
• Low-power consumption
• with clock-recovery is supported to eliminate the 48 MHz crystal. It is used for USB
device-only implementation.
33.3 Functional description
USBFS communicates with the processor core through status registers, control registers,
and data structures in memory.
33.3.1 Data Structures
To efficiently manage USB endpoint communications, USBFS implements a Buffer
Descriptor Table (BDT) in system memory. See
532
Host PC
USB Cable
Root
Hub
USB Cable
USB Cables
KL27 Sub-Family Reference Manual , Rev. 5, 01/2016
External Hub
External Hub
USB Peripherals
Figure
33-7.
Freescale Semiconductor, Inc.
USB Cable